Nilza S. Louis-Jean is a public health professional with over six years of experience in health policy, research, and clinical operations. As a first generation Haitian American women and public health professional, Nilza is dedicated to increasing accessibility amongst marginalized communities through program implementation and revised policies.
Nilza has earned her Masters’ in Public Health (MPH) concentrating in Policy and Management from New York University (NYU) as well as her Bachelor of Science in Health Promotion and Wellness from Farmingdale State College (FSC).
Nilza starts her journey as a DrPH candidate at New York Medical College (NYMC) in Fall 2025 where she plans to deepen her public health knowledge in order advance into a leadership position that would allow her to pour back into future public health professionals through mentorship, as was done for her.
